Error in v-on handler: "TypeError: Cannot read properties of undefined (reading '$refs')" found in
时间: 2023-10-14 20:04:19 浏览: 145
引用:在Vue中,当使用v-on绑定的事件处理函数中出现"TypeError: Cannot read properties of undefined (reading '$refs')"的错误时,可能是由于在事件处理函数中尝试访问未定义的$refs属性。这通常是因为在事件处理函数中使用了this.$refs来访问组件的引用,但是该组件的引用还未被正确地定义或绑定。引用:解决这个问题的一种方法是确保在访问this.$refs之前,组件的引用已经被正确地定义或绑定。可以通过在组件的mounted生命周期钩子函数中执行相关的绑定操作来确保组件引用的正确性。引用:另外,还需要注意的是,当访问this.$refs时,要确保所访问的组件在模板中已经正确地使用了ref属性并赋予了唯一的标识符。只有这样,才能正确地使用this.$refs来访问组件的引用。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[报错 | vue.runtime.esm....c320:4560 [Vue warn]: Error in render: “TypeError: Cannot read properties of](https://blog.csdn.net/muziqwyk/article/details/126191223)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[vue表单校验报错 Error in v-on handler: “TypeError: Cannot read properties of undefined (reading ...](https://blog.csdn.net/LiDeKang1/article/details/124243339)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文